Starry Night Ball Set To Light Up Tumut
Published on 11 March 2026
Young people across the Snowy Valleys are invited to dress up, hit the dance floor and celebrate with friends at the inaugural SVC Youth Council Starry Night Ball on Saturday 18 April at Club Tumut.
Open to ages 16–24, the event promises a vibrant night of music, glamour and party-style fun, with DJ Voydy keeping the dance party going and professional photos by Grant Hardwick capturing the memories.
A Council spokesperson said the ball is designed by young people for young people, providing the opportunity to enjoy a fun and memorable night out.
“This is a great opportunity for young people to dress up, gather their friends and enjoy a night of music, dancing and celebration,” the spokesperson said.
“We’re really excited to see the community come together to support the Youth Council’s first Starry Night Ball.”
Tickets include entry, finger foods, cake and non-alcoholic drinks, with alcoholic beverages available for purchase for those aged 18+.
Cocktail attire is encouraged, and all eyes will be on the dancefloor as the King and Queen of the Ball are crowned during the evening.
Early bird tickets are now available for $45, before increasing to $65 closer to the event date. A return bus from Tumbarumba and Batlow is also available for $10pp.
